Mediation service
Derby Homes offers a free mediation service. It is used to resolve issues between two or more people. It can be effective either when someone is in breach of their tenancy conditions or if a person’s actions are causing a nuisance.
When relations between people break down or individuals cause a nuisance to others, often the first thought is that it can only be resolved through court action. The legal processes involved in taking court action are both long and expensive. They may not even resolve the underlying issues.
We encourage you to inform us if you have any issues and consider mediation as a way of improving the situation.
Our mediation service is unbiased, private, confidential and informal. It is delivered by our qualified Mediation Officer along with trained volunteers who have excellent communication and listening skills. It has been in place since August 2011 and has already had some success in resolving issues.
The service is for tenants, leaseholders and others within the community. If you or someone you know has an issue or an ongoing dispute with someone else, ask your housing officer about a mediation referral.
